Monthly Costs in South Dakota
| Category | Low Est. | High Est. |
|---|---|---|
| FoodMedium-large breed - 2-3 cups quality kibble daily | $50 | $81 |
| Vet RoutineAnnualized routine preventive care - Poodles are generally healthy | $27 | $45 |
| GroomingNon-shedding coat must be clipped every 6-8 weeks - professional cost $90-$140+ per session | $72 | $135 |
| Treats & ToysIntelligent breed - enrichment toys and puzzle feeders are worth the investment | $18 | $36 |
| Pet InsuranceRecommended - Addison's disease and bloat are breed-specific risks | $36 | $68 |
| Total Monthly | $203 | $365 |

Frequently Asked Questions
Are Standard Poodles expensive to groom?
Yes - grooming is the highest ongoing cost for Poodle owners. Professional grooming every 6-8 weeks costs $90-$140+ per session, totaling $675-$1,400+ per year just for grooming. Some owners invest in professional-grade clippers ($150-$300) to do maintenance trims at home between appointments.
Are Poodles healthy dogs?
Standard Poodles are generally healthy and long-lived compared to many breeds. Common health concerns include Addison's disease (a manageable hormonal condition), bloat/GDV (a life-threatening emergency), progressive retinal atrophy, and hip dysplasia - all of which are reduced by buying from health-tested parents.
What size Poodle is cheapest to own?
Toy Poodles are the least expensive to own - their tiny size means dramatically lower food, medication, and equipment costs. Grooming costs are similar across sizes (per session pricing). Standard Poodles cost the most due to food, larger medication doses, and higher insurance premiums.
How long do Standard Poodles live?
Standard Poodles are among the longest-lived large dog breeds, with an average lifespan of 12-15 years. This longer lifespan means higher lifetime costs but also a longer relationship with your pet. Some Poodles live to 17-18 years with good care.
